Centralisation of Sanctions
1. Records of cautions, expulsions and match suspensions are stored in the central computer system of FIFA. The Disciplinary Committee sec- retariat confi rms them in writing to the association or club concerned or, in the case of fi nal competitions, to the head of the delegation concerned.
2 This confi rmation serves only as notifi cation: sanctions (cautions, expulsions, automatic match suspensions) have an immediate effect on subsequent matches even if the letter of confi rmation reaches the association, club or head of delegation concerned later.
3 To ensure that the central registration system functions properly, the confederations shall inform FIFA of sanctions that have been pro- nounced during their own competitions and are likely to be carried over to a FIFA competition (cf. art. 39 par.
2) and future competi- tions.
